Liberia: Women Participate in Feast

Liberian women are said to have participated in the seventh day feast of the eleven Guinean military officers who died in a plane crash on February 11, 2013.

The women converged at the Guinean Embassy in Monrovia on Sunday, February 17, 2013 to express their condolences to the Government, women and people of Guinea for the death of their citizens.

"As women and people of the Mano River Union, we mourn with you, pray with you and share your loss. As wives, mothers, daughters and sisters, most of us have gone through the pains resulting from the loss of our husbands, sons and brothers during the civil war in our country," the women lamented.

They admonished Guineans to use the plane crash incident as a means to further solidify the brotherly ties between the countries of the Mano River, ECOWAS and Africa, adding "let us be our brothers and sisters' keeper."
